THE MOMENT A COMPLAINT APPEARS

What it does

An AI Employee recognizes a complaint, collects the facts, thanks the customer, and opens a handoff to the owner you assign. It does not argue, and it does not publish a response unless you approve one.

The problem

Complaints arrive in DMs, reviews, and the front desk. They bounce around until someone owns them, and the customer gets louder.

Trigger

Starts the moment a complaint appears.

Human controls

  • Public replies are drafts, not auto-published.
  • You assign complaint owners by issue type.
  • The AI should not offer credits or admissions you did not authorize.

Workflow steps

  1. 1A negative or frustrated message is detected on a connected channel.
  2. 2The AI Employee acknowledges the customer and gathers details.
  3. 3It creates or updates a record with the complaint summary.
  4. 4The right owner is notified.
  5. 5Any public reply stays in draft until you approve it.

Example use case

A Facebook message says a technician left a mess. The AI Employee apologizes that this happened, asks for the address and time, and notifies the operations manager in Slack with the thread. No public comment is posted.
